HP ProBook 4520s
Microsoft Windows 10 (64-bit)

Hi I have a problem with my HP ProBook 4520s I am trying to install windows 10 64bit on it, I got in to the bios and enabled usb boot but when I go to the boot options to pick the hard drive or usb/CD it keep giving me a error (an error occurred with the boot selection verify media is present and retry)

I enabled USB DEVICE BOOT,UEFI BOOT ORDER AND LEGACY BOOT ORDER and all the other settings and it still won't work is there a trick to it or am I just missing something
